4 Benefits of Choosing a Family Dentist

Family smiling at routine dental appointment

At first, having a specialist for each member of your family may sound like a good idea. However, a few months of driving across town for braces appointments, routine cleanings, and sudden toothaches will make you seriously reconsider. Fortunately, you can free your schedule without compromising the high-quality care you deserve by choosing a family dentist in Oshkosh! Read on for four benefits that you and your family will love.

#1. It Simplifies Your Dental Care

From elderly patients to small children, a family dentist can treat every member of your household at one convenient location. That way, you can say goodbye to the headache of coordinating your family’s dental appointments with different providers on different days. Instead, you can schedule all the services you need at one convenient location and simplify your life!

#2. Enjoy a Comprehensive Array of Services

Since family dentists center their practice around treating patients of all ages, they specialize in offering a comprehensive array of services. So, if an older member of your family needs to be fitted for dentures, your teen wants to straighten their teeth with braces, or you want to upgrade your smile with a professional teeth whitening treatment, they are ready to help!

#3. It’s Easier to Track Your Dental History

Jumping from provider to provider can make tracking down your dental history a nightmare. However, if you have established a relationship with one dentist, then all the X-rays, charts, and previous treatments can be easily located. Plus, you won’t have to worry about anything falling through the cracks!

#4. Help Prevent Dental Anxiety

Did you know that 20% of school-aged children have a dental phobia? Plus, nearly 50% of adults experience moderate to severe anxiety around going to the dentist. Fortunately, having a dentist who is more a member of your family than a stranger can take the fear out of routine appointments. By watching you (and your whole family) comfortably get the treatment they need, your little one can follow suit and grow up to practice good oral health habits.
